Health Alert: DPHSS Issues Voluntary Recall for Bicillin L-A Injectable Solution

If you’re in the Guam gaming community, you might have heard the recent buzz about the Department of Public Health and Social Services (DPHSS) issuing a recall alert for certain lots of Bicillin® L-A (Penicillin G Benzathine Injectable Solution). This isn’t just some technical health jargon; it’s vital info that could impact your health and wellbeing.

So, what’s the deal? DPHSS found some particulates in the injectable solution during routine inspections, which could cause serious health risks if injected. We’re talking everything from tissue inflammation to potentially life-threatening complications, like embolism. Not a fun combo, right? The products in question were manufactured by King Pharmaceuticals, a subsidiary of Pfizer, and distributed through ExpressMed Pharmacy.

The good news is that ExpressMed has been proactive. They’ve worked with DPHSS to yank the affected products off the shelves, ensuring nobody ends up with a hazardous dose. They’ve got their heads in the game, collaborating with the manufacturer to handle returns and safe disposal. That’s a win for all of us who frequent local pharmacies!

As of now, DPHSS hasn’t received any reports of adverse health effects linked to the recalled lots here in Guam. But if you’ve gotten a shot from the affected batches and are feeling unwell, it’s time to hit up your healthcare provider. It’s always better to be safe than sorry when it comes to your health.

For those who need some extra info, you can reach out to Pfizer’s Medical Information at 800-438-1985 (option 3), Monday to Friday, from 9 AM to 5 PM ET, or contact their Drug Safety hotline 24/7 at 800-438-1985 (option 1). For local concerns, DPHSS has set up a consumer commodities program line at (671) 300-9579. Stay safe, Guam gamers—your health matters!
